数据仓库分层模型设计指南
数据仓库分层是数据治理的重要环节,合理的分层设计可以提高数据质量、降低维护成本、提升开发效率。本文将详细介绍数据仓库的分层模型设计。
1. 分层模型概述
1.1 分层目的
- 提高数据质量
- 降低维护成本
- 提升开发效率
- 便于数据治理
- 支持数据复用
1.2 分层原则
- 数据血缘清晰
- 层次职责明确
- 数据流向规范
- 便于数据回溯
- 支持数据复用
2. 标准分层模型
2.1 ODS层(Operation Data Store)
2.1.1 主要职责
- 原始数据存储
- 数据格式保持
- 数据备份
- 数据同步
- 数据校验
2.1.2 数据特点
- 保持原始数据
- 不做数据转换
- 支持数据回溯
- 保留历史数据
- 数据量大
2.1.3 命名规范
ods_{数据源}_{表名}
示例:ods_mysql_user_info

最低0.47元/天 解锁文章
1092

被折叠的 条评论
为什么被折叠?



